Ingredients
1x
2x
3x
2
cups
fresh spinach
washed and dried
1
avocado
peeled, pitted, and sliced
1/4
cup
cherry tomatoes
halved
1/4
cup
red onion
thinly sliced
2
tablespoons
olive oil
1
tablespoon
lemon juice
freshly squeezed
1
teaspoon
honey
1/4
teaspoon
salt
1/4
teaspoon
black pepper
freshly ground
Instructions
In a large salad bowl, combine the spinach, avocado, cherry tomatoes, and red onion.
In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, lemon juice, honey, salt, and black pepper to make the dressing.
Drizzle the dressing over the salad and gently toss to combine.
Serve immediately and enjoy your healthy Spinach and Avocado Salad.
